    A professional locksmith can reprogram your key programming car using specific software. They can connect their computer to the OBD port on your vehicle (this is often underneath the dashboard). They'll utilize this software to match the key with the vehicle's settings. This will protect your key from being used by a third party to steal your car.

    A key chip is an embedded microchip in the car key that transmits radio signals at a low level. This signals the immobilizer to disengage and allow you to start the car. These chips also come with a digital serial number that authenticates the key and helps prevent auto theft. You can find an exchange for your lost key by calling locksmith.     The first step in making a new key program is to purchase a blank key that matches the chip in your vehicle. They are available at hardware stores or auto parts stores. You'll need to locate the ECU on your vehicle. You can find it under the dashboard, but you should consult your owner's manual to confirm. You'll need to connect the diagnostic device after you have located the ECU. The device will communicate with the car's modules and program them to accept new keys.

    There are many different ways to program a key according to the make and model of your car. For instance, certain brands require a special device to connect the blank key fob programing near me to the ECU. Some brands have a simple process that works with all models. Refer to the owner's manual or a professional technician prior to you begin the process of reprogramming to determine the best tool for your vehicle.

    Most auto locksmiths say that the onboard programming method is the most efficient. It can take just one minute when you follow the steps correctly. The OBD2 and EEPROM methods are more complicated and can take about a half hour or more to complete. Moreover, these processes are risky and come with the potential to corrupt the information on the module.

    Transponder technology is utilized in many vehicles to prevent theft. This means that they must be programmed in order to match the anti-theft system in your vehicle. A locksmith for cars or mechanic can accomplish this. This is a costly process that requires a specific software and equipment that is specialized. DIY is a method to save money, however it's risky and could damage the system.

    In some cars the onboard computer has an electronic lock which limits the number of times a locksmith is able to program it. These systems are operated by tokens. This means that each programming attempt has to be paid for with a pre-paid token. This cost is included in the cost of the programming service.
